A revised edition of a definitive anthology of women's writing in the Renaissance. * Contains specially designed annotations to suit the needs of the undergraduate student * Focuses on the key issue of femininity in Renaissance England * Contains a new introduction which brings the book right into the 21st century

Acknowledgements Preface to the Second Edition by Christina Luckyj Introduction 1. PREAMBLE: WOMEN'S SELF-IMAGE AS WRITERS Margaret Tyler Anne Dowriche Rachel Speght Elizabeth Jocelin 2. PROSE Katherine Parr, Queen of England Anne Askew Jane Anger Elizabeth Grymeston Dorothy Leigh Rachel Speght Elizabeth Caldwell Elizabeth Clinton Elizabeth Cary 3. AUTOBIOGRAPHY Margaret, Lady Hoby Grace, Lady Mildmay Mary Ward Lady Anne Clifford 4. VERSE Isabella Whitney Mary (Sidney) Herbert Anne Dowriche Aemilia Lanyer Lady Mary Wroth Rachel Speght Textual notes Bibliography
